01 前言Kubernetes(以下简称k8s)宣布在1.20版本之后将弃用docker作为容器运行时,在2021年末发布的1.23版本中将彻底移除dockershim组件。Dockershim是kubelet内置的一个组件,功能是使k8s能够通过CRI(Container Runtime Interface)操作docker。一旦docker 有任何的功能特性变更,dockershim 代码必须
转载 2023-08-23 16:22:17
199阅读
场景在docker的使用中随着下载镜像越来越多,构建镜像、运行容器越来越多, 数据目录必然会逐渐增大;当所有docker镜像、容器对磁盘的使用达到上限时,就需要对数据目录进行迁移如何避免:1.在安装前对/var/lib/dockerdocker默认数据存储目录)目录进行扩容; 2.在docker安装完成后,修改docker默认存储位置为磁盘容量较大的位置;规避迁移数据过程中造成的风险。前置工作
转载 2023-07-04 11:44:33
951阅读
# 如何迁移Docker ## 背景 在软件开发过程中,我们经常会使用Docker来容器化应用程序,以便在不同的环境中进行部署和运行。然而,当我们需要将应用程序从一个环境迁移到另一个环境时,我们需要使用一些迁移策略来确保顺利完成迁移过程。本文将介绍如何迁移Docker容器以解决一个具体的问题。 ## 问题描述 假设我们有一个运行在Docker容器中的Web应用程序,它使用MySQL数据库作为后
原创 2023-10-05 15:08:37
55阅读
这几天抽了个时间,终于把自己阿里云ecs的os升级到了centos7,所以也打算把博客wordpress也升级下,同时还要使用现在比较火的docker技术。下面把相关wordpress迁移docker中的相关步骤记录下。PS:强烈建议OS使用3.0以上内核。一、备份wordpress数据在正式迁移wordpress之前,我们需要备份wordpress的相关数据,包括数据库、图片以及主题。有关wo
    今天群里问了一个用dd命令是否可以克隆Linux系统到另外一块新的硬盘上的问题,    dd命令转换和复制文件,按照原理来看dd是按照磁盘结构进行复制,是可以把一块硬盘上的东西按照原有的结构复制到另外一块硬盘应该行.        但是原理必须要靠实践才能说明,
# Kettle如何迁移Docker 随着容器化技术的普及,将传统的数据处理工具迁移Docker环境中,已经成为了很多企业的需求。本文将详细介绍如何将Kettle(Pentaho Data Integration)迁移Docker中,并提供相关的步骤和代码示例。 ## 什么是Kettle? Kettle(也称为Pentaho Data Integration,简称PDI)是一个开源的数
原创 9月前
51阅读
很多时候,我们面临这样一个问题:已经在磁盘(I)中装好了一个Linux系统,也装好了各种软件,此时,如果想原封不动的把系统复制给别人,或者给其他的磁盘,该如何操作。这里就涉及linux系统的迁移与复制。笔者不想提linux的dd命令,其速度可以和蜗牛比赛,这里想提到的方法就是系统文件复制:把磁盘(I)中已经装好的系统文件原封不动的复制给磁盘(J),然后,需要修改磁盘(J)中系统的部分参数和系统引导
# Docker容器如何迁移目录 Docker是一种容器化技术,它使用轻量级的虚拟化技术,允许开发者将应用程序及其所有依赖打包到一个独立的容器中。在使用Docker的过程中,有时候我们需要迁移容器的目录,可能是为了备份数据、迁移至新的服务器或者将容器从一个主机迁移到另一个主机。本文将介绍如何迁移Docker容器的目录,包括迁移挂载的数据卷和迁移容器的文件系统。 ## 挂载目录的迁移 当我们运
原创 2023-08-15 09:21:14
589阅读
我们经常会遇到搭建多节点集群得需求, 例如摩根推出的基于以太坊的区块链 Quorum. 对于这种搭建多借点得需求, 我一般都是先通过 docker-compose 在本地实现多节点, 然后再基于 docker-compose 迁移到 Kubernetes .这样做是因为基于 docker-compose 来实现要简单很多:调试很方便;多节点间通过 Volume Map 可以很容易 地实现数据共享;
转载 2023-08-23 18:06:34
16阅读
docker容器如何迁移迁移容器涉及到备份和恢复,可以将任何一个docker容器从一台机器迁移到另一台机器。在迁移过程中,首先将把容器备份为Docker镜像快照。然后,该Docker镜像或者是被推送到Docker注册中心,或者被作为tar包文件保存到本地。如果我们将镜像推送到了Docker注册中心,可以从任何想要的机器上使用 docker run 命令来恢复并运行该容器。如果将镜像打包成tar包
转载 2023-07-14 22:07:36
535阅读
  前言 前面已经写了两篇关于docker的博文了,在工作中有关docker的基本操作已经基本讲解完了。相信现在大家已经能够熟练配置docker以及使用docker来创建镜像以及容器了。本篇博客将会讲解如何让容器中的一个目录与宿主机的一个目录进行绑定。这样就可以实现容器与宿主机之间的文件共享。 例如:我们只要把网站数据放到宿主机的共享文件中,无需再频繁登录容
Image镜像的迁移,适用于离线环境。一般离线环境,都会自建Docker Registry。 无论 官方的 ,还是最近流行的 Harbor ,都是不错的选择。 但是,这个世界上就是有些环境,或者说一些环境在某些时期,没有外网,也没有内部的Registry。 这个时候要部署Docker的服务,怎么办?只能通过镜像的迁移。 实际上, Harbor&nb
转载 2023-09-26 15:36:52
202阅读
前言被领导要求部署一个和测试环境一样的演示环境,并且数据库也要同步过去,服务器上的各种服务都是docker部署的,由于之前docker玩的比较少,所以还是踩了不少坑的,在此记录一下正确的操作方法。正文1.容器镜像导出我们先通过docker images查看需要导出的镜像然后我们使用镜像导出命令docker save -o /home/备份包名.tar 镜像id或镜像名 -o(即output) 或
转载 2023-09-01 14:05:50
268阅读
环境:Centos7.5使用Docker安装的Oracle要对同一内网下装有Oracle的两台服务器数据迁移(导出与导入),使用exp和imp命令1、将服务器A内数据库中的数据使用exp导出到服务器B数据库目录下2、将导入到服务器B目录下的dmp文件使用imp导入服务器B上的数据库内首先在服务器B上需要配置一个tnsname,然后使用tnsping测试B是否能够连接到服务器A上的数据库,这是
转载 2023-12-09 16:52:23
146阅读
镜像下载、域名解析、时间同步请点击 阿里云开源镜像站背景在Linux中安装oracle非常麻烦,相信每个人也会遇到各种坑。为了一次装好,也方便将来直接可以导出镜像在各平台移植使用,所以选择用docker安装拉取镜像在 DockerHub 上搜索 Oracle 可以找到 Oracle 的官方镜像,地址:https://hub.docker.com/注意,这里使用 docker pull oracle
转载 2023-07-27 21:05:26
165阅读
环境:Centos7.5使用Docker安装的Oracle要对同一内网下装有Oracle的两台服务器数据迁移(导出与导入),使用exp和imp命令1、将服务器A内数据库中的数据使用exp导出到服务器B数据库目录下2、将导入到服务器B目录下的dmp文件使用imp导入服务器B上的数据库内首先在服务器B上需要配置一个tnsname,然后使用tnsping测试B是否能够连接到服务器A上的数据库,这是所有操
转载 2023-08-01 20:18:41
145阅读
目录docker容器迁移容器与宿主机通信杂碎docker容器迁移我是先以从仓库pull下来的ubuntu 21.04镜像创建容器并进行设置,然后现在想把配置好的容器做成一个可以复制移动的效果方法:把容器打包成镜像,镜像可以压缩成tar文件传输,到目的地再解压导入镜像。容器打包成镜像指令:docker commit [-m="提交的描述信息"] [-a="创建者"] 容器名称|容器ID 生成的镜像名
转载 2023-07-18 20:47:46
117阅读
# 如何Docker进行系统迁移 在日常工作中,经常会遇到需要迁移系统或应用的情况,而使用Docker可以简化系统迁移的过程,保证系统迁移的顺利进行。本文将介绍如何使用Docker进行系统迁移,并给出具体的方案和代码示例。 ## 方案 系统迁移涉及到将现有系统或应用迁移到新的环境中,而使用Docker可以将整个应用及其依赖项打包成一个可移植的镜像,从而实现系统迁移的无缝切换。 具体方案如
原创 2024-04-20 06:25:42
65阅读
# 从Docker迁移到Container ## 简介 在容器化应用程序的过程中,有时候我们可能需要从Docker迁移到其他容器技术,如Containerd。本文将介绍如何将一个应用程序从Docker迁移到Containerd,并提供详细的步骤和代码示例。 ## 步骤 ### 1. 安装Containerd 首先,我们需要安装Containerd。可以通过以下命令进行安装: ```shel
原创 2024-06-22 03:40:48
148阅读
0.背景需要把云服务器上用docker搭建的大数据集群迁移到本地的主机上。大数据集群有一个master主节点和slave01、slave02两个计算节点。云上服务器和本地的主机的数量都只有一台,是采用docker虚拟化的方式搭建大数据集群。要求迁移后数据不会丢失。1.用export&import 还是 save & load ?export&import 和 save &a
  • 1
  • 2
  • 3
  • 4
  • 5